Color Coded Tough-Tags will not come off in rotors, cyclers or racks. They are resistant to extreme temperatures and the matte surface is suitable for pencil, pen or marker.
These Tough-TagsŪ are designed to fit 1.5mL tubes and stay on in centrifuge rotors, thermal cyclers, and racks even at extreme temperatures. The matte surface may be marked with pen, pencil or marker.
Color-coded Dual Tough-TagsŪ are available in five colors. A set consists of one 7/16" spot (11.1mm) and one 1-1/4" x 9/16" rectangular label (31.8 x 14.3mm). Supplied 500 sets per roll
Tough-TagsŪ are chemically inert polyester labels that strongly adhere to all plastics and other materials. They are temperature resistant from -40°F to 250°F (-40°C to 121°C). These labels will withstand autoclaving, boiling water baths, freezer temperatures, organic solvents, caustic agents and other challenges without peeling, cracking or falling off. For best adhesion it is recommended that siliconized surfaces be avoided.
Tough-TagsŪ are precut, peel-off labels which accept any marking instrument and are perfectly sized to fit microcentrifuge tubes and other containers in the laboratory. Tubes with Tough-TagsŪ wrapped around them will still slide easily in and out of rotors without binding because the labels are thin and the adhesive does not migrate from behind the label even after boiling and autoclaving.
